Role: Vice President — Sourcing, Development & Production
Location: Shanghai
Reports to: CEO

About the role
We’re hiring a hands-on senior leader to own end-to-end product creation and delivery for our apparel business from concept and development through factory production and on-time delivery. This role requires strong commercial judgment, vendor management experience, and the ability to operate in ambiguity as we build and scale.

Key responsibilities

  • Lead product development: Drive concept-to-sample cycles, approve tech packs, and ensure fit/quality meet retailer standards.
  • Own sourcing strategy and vendor relationships: Secure capacity, negotiate costs, and commercial terms.
  • Source new factories: Identify, vet, and onboard manufacturing partners to expand capacity and capabilities; run audits and negotiate terms.
  • Manage production: Build master schedules, prioritize orders, oversee QA/inspections, and ensure on-time, on-spec delivery.
  • Improve operations: Implement process/technology improvements (PLM/ERP, lean practices) to reduce lead time and cost.
  • Ensure compliance: Manage vendor audits, safety, and social responsibility standards.
  • Lead the team: Coach and develop development, sourcing, and production staff; provide regular updates to the executive team.
  • Partner cross-functionally: Work with Sales, Design, Merchandising, Supply Chain, and Finance.

Requirements

Success measures (examples)

  • On-time delivery to retail
  • Defect/return rate improvements
  • Reduced sample-to-production lead time
  • Number of qualified new factories onboarded and vendor scorecard improvements
  • Production cost variance within target

Qualifications

  • 10+ years in apparel product development, sourcing and production (senior leadership preferred).
  • Proven experience with factory identification/onboarding, factory management, costing/negotiation, and QA programs.
  • Strong commercial acumen, results orientation, and excellent English communication skills.
  • Willingness to travel to vendor sites.
